St Paul’s Cathedral is the Anglican cathedral of the Diocese of Melbourne, located on Flinders Street in the central business district. It is the seat of the Anglican Archbishop of Melbourne.

Sited immediately opposite Federation Square and adjacent to Flinders Street Station, the cathedral’s red-brick Gothic Revival exterior is a familiar element of Melbourne’s cityscape. The interior includes a nave and choir, stained glass windows and a large pipe organ; the building also hosts regular worship services, concerts and civic events.

The present building dates from the late 19th century and was designed in the Gothic Revival manner; it has been modified and restored at various times since its construction and has long served as the diocese’s principal church.

The cathedral stands on Flinders Street at the north bank of the Yarra River in Melbourne’s CBD, within walking distance of major city landmarks and tram connections.

How to Get to St Paul's Cathedral, Melbourne #

St Paul’s Cathedral sits on Flinders Lane near Federation Square and is a short walk from Flinders Street Station. Numerous tram routes run along Flinders Street and Swanston Street, with easy pedestrian access.

Weather & Climate near St Paul's Cathedral, Melbourne #

Climate

St Paul's Cathedral, Melbourne's climate is classified as Oceanic - Oceanic climate with warm summers (peaking in February) and cold winters (coldest in July). Temperatures range from 6°C to 26°C. Moderate rainfall (647 mm/year), distributed fairly evenly throughout the year.
